Other topics covered in 2023
- PUBLISHED PANEL: We didn’t manage to get this together, though guest speakers/authors answered most of our questions
- WRITING CONTESTS: We added challenges to some contests, for the benefit of writers who want something more of a challenge. We also changed the format, emphasizing the role of readers in our contests, and pointing out that the submissions for a free ezine for our members.
- WRITING EXERCISES: We managed to include a few of these.
- GROUP CRITIQUES: We did some near the start of the year but they tailed off. Should we work harder to encourage group critiques this year?
